Re: [MMUSIC] Comment on SIP Trickle ICE based on INFO draft
"Parthasarathi R" <partha@parthasarathi.co.in> Sun, 23 March 2014 11:00 UTC
Return-Path: <partha@parthasarathi.co.in>
X-Original-To: mmusic@ietfa.amsl.com
Delivered-To: mmusic@ietfa.amsl.com
Received: from localhost (ietfa.amsl.com [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id 7A2611A09B3 for <mmusic@ietfa.amsl.com>; Sun, 23 Mar 2014 04:00:34 -0700 (PDT)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: 0.699
X-Spam-Level:
X-Spam-Status: No, score=0.699 tagged_above=-999 required=5 tests=[BAYES_50=0.8,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, DKIM_VALID_AU=-0.1, SPF_PASS=-0.001] autolearn=ham
Received: from mail.ietf.org ([4.31.198.44]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id US522roVgWW5 for <mmusic@ietfa.amsl.com>; Sun, 23 Mar 2014 04:00:21 -0700 (PDT)
Received: from outbound.mailhostbox.com (outbound.mailhostbox.com [162.222.225.25]) by ietfa.amsl.com (Postfix) with ESMTP id 355571A0997 for <mmusic@ietf.org>; Sun, 23 Mar 2014 04:00:03 -0700 (PDT)
Received: from userPC (unknown [122.167.205.77]) (Authenticated sender: partha@parthasarathi.co.in) by outbound.mailhostbox.com (Postfix) with ESMTPA id 48562868A8D; Sun, 23 Mar 2014 10:59:57 +0000 (GMT)
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=parthasarathi.co.in; s=20120823; t=1395572403; bh=bbnOJhE5bdoGL4twdmpgLzNbiGNT8vIGmuz4li/Aes8=; h=From:To:Cc:References:In-Reply-To:Subject:Date:Message-ID: MIME-Version:Content-Type:Content-Transfer-Encoding; b=acQeJc58sZA8LC9Cx4N1NWLTbF7YTTkfW/h3whxW4zWa4dNZxZB45KH6j+Sp5Zq+o V7vCw/oYPhbJ1C+QEBwfmSHS6aTHmjtLrursk0pNiG79geIUmErI190PZvAcv1X3sp jUd7MY59NSNiGxoEzlCRd5bAgVgkH1c1B2ox5G+A=
From: Parthasarathi R <partha@parthasarathi.co.in>
To: 'Emil Ivov' <emcho@jitsi.org>, "'Enrico Marocco (TiLab)'" <enrico.marocco@telecomitalia.it>, 'Christer Holmberg' <christer.holmberg@ericsson.com>
References: <01e601cf423c$57255890$057009b0$@co.in>
In-Reply-To: <01e601cf423c$57255890$057009b0$@co.in>
Date: Sun, 23 Mar 2014 16:29:53 +0530
Message-ID: <00c901cf4687$0a48dbb0$1eda9310$@co.in>
MIME-Version: 1.0
Content-Type: text/plain; charset="us-ascii"
Content-Transfer-Encoding: 7bit
X-Mailer: Microsoft Office Outlook 12.0
Thread-Index: Ac9CPFJy24/vzsmBSZKQcuFN40F13QESLNjg
Content-Language: en-us
X-CTCH-RefID: str=0001.0A020204.532EBEB2.00A4, ss=1, re=0.000, recu=0.000, reip=0.000, cl=1, cld=1, fgs=0
X-CTCH-VOD: Unknown
X-CTCH-Spam: Unknown
X-CTCH-Score: 0.000
X-CTCH-Rules:
X-CTCH-Flags: 0
X-CTCH-ScoreCust: 0.000
X-CTCH-SenderID: partha@parthasarathi.co.in
X-CTCH-SenderID-TotalMessages: 1
X-CTCH-SenderID-TotalSpam: 0
X-CTCH-SenderID-TotalSuspected: 0
X-CTCH-SenderID-TotalBulk: 0
X-CTCH-SenderID-TotalConfirmed: 0
X-CTCH-SenderID-TotalRecipients: 0
X-CTCH-SenderID-TotalVirus: 0
X-CTCH-SenderID-BlueWhiteFlag: 0
X-Scanned-By: MIMEDefang 2.72 on 172.18.214.93
Archived-At: http://mailarchive.ietf.org/arch/msg/mmusic/CfkDlzSz-Mi30g_MBNRbGSEsls0
Cc: mmusic@ietf.org
Subject: Re: [MMUSIC] Comment on SIP Trickle ICE based on INFO draft
X-BeenThere: mmusic@ietf.org
X-Mailman-Version: 2.1.15
Precedence: list
List-Id: Multiparty Multimedia Session Control Working Group <mmusic.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/options/mmusic>, <mailto:mmusic-request@ietf.org?subject=unsubscribe>
List-Archive: <http://www.ietf.org/mail-archive/web/mmusic/>
List-Post: <mailto:mmusic@ietf.org>
List-Help: <mailto:mmusic-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/mmusic>, <mailto:mmusic-request@ietf.org?subject=subscribe>
X-List-Received-Date: Sun, 23 Mar 2014 11:00:35 -0000
Hi all, The below mentioned UPDATE overlap with INFO usecase and INFO forking scenario has to be clarified before adopting this draft as WG item as I'm not seeing any solution with INFO based mechanism. Thanks Partha > -----Original Message----- > From: mmusic [mailto:mmusic-bounces@ietf.org] On Behalf Of > Parthasarathi R > Sent: Tuesday, March 18, 2014 5:25 AM > To: 'Emil Ivov'; 'Enrico Marocco (TiLab)'; 'Christer Holmberg' > Cc: mmusic@ietf.org > Subject: [MMUSIC] Comment on SIP Trickle based on INFO draft > > Hi all, > > SIP Trickle INFO is projected as the back channel for collecting the > candidates in IETF-89 MMUSIC meeting. Unfortunately, it impacts > Offer/answer > (RFC 3264) in case one another offer/answer started before SIP trickle > INFO > is completed. The race condition between second offer/answer and > earlier SIP > trickle INFO is not stated in the draft-ivov-mmusic-trickle-ice-sip. I > have > explained those issues in > http://www.ietf.org/mail-archive/web/mmusic/current/msg12666.html and > no > reply from you folks. This race condition is very much possible during > early > dialog scenarios with UPDATE. > > Could you please explain how SIP trickle ICE using INFO works for > > 1) UPDATE from remote before Trickle ICE is completed > > a) INVITE from local > b) 183 session progress from remote > c) PRACK from local > d) INFO from local (relay candidates) > e) UPDATE from remote > > Here, the remote has to consider whether INFO belongs to UPDATE or > INVITE as > it is possible for INFO to reach before 200 OK for UPDATE as well in > the > same sequence. Also, RFC 2976 clarifies that > > " - The extensions that use the INFO message MUST NOT rely on the > INFO message to do anything that effects the SIP call state or the > state of related sessions." > > But SIP Trickle ICE state is depend upon the "state of related > sessions" as > UPDATE would have change the state in the remote. > > 2) Trickle ICE INFO with serial forking > > a) INVITE from local > b) INVITE is forked by proxy to first remote destination > c) 100 trying is reaching local > d) INFO with Trickle ICE from local > e) INFO is forward by proxy to first remote destination > f) INVITE is forked by proxy to second remote destination > g) Whether INFO has to be forked? > > It is not mentioned in the draft whether INFO has to be forked to the > second > remote destination as well. Could you please explain the expect > behavior for > this scenario. > > Thanks > Partha > > _______________________________________________ > mmusic mailing list > mmusic@ietf.org > https://www.ietf.org/mailman/listinfo/mmusic
- Re: [MMUSIC] Comment on SIP Trickle ICE based on … Paul Kyzivat
- Re: [MMUSIC] Comment on SIP Trickle ICE based on … Emil Ivov
- [MMUSIC] Comment on SIP Trickle based on INFO dra… Parthasarathi R
- Re: [MMUSIC] Comment on SIP Trickle ICE based on … Parthasarathi R
- Re: [MMUSIC] Comment on SIP Trickle ICE based on … Emil Ivov
- Re: [MMUSIC] Comment on SIP Trickle ICE based on … Parthasarathi R
- Re: [MMUSIC] Comment on SIP Trickle ICE based on … Emil Ivov
- Re: [MMUSIC] Comment on SIP Trickle ICE based on … Paul Kyzivat
- Re: [MMUSIC] Comment on SIP Trickle ICE based on … Parthasarathi R
- Re: [MMUSIC] Comment on SIP Trickle ICE based on … Parthasarathi R
- Re: [MMUSIC] Comment on SIP Trickle ICE based on … Paul Kyzivat
- Re: [MMUSIC] Comment on SIP Trickle ICE based on … Emil Ivov
- Re: [MMUSIC] Comment on SIP Trickle ICE based on … Emil Ivov
- Re: [MMUSIC] Comment on SIP Trickle ICE based on … Christer Holmberg
- Re: [MMUSIC] Comment on SIP Trickle ICE based on … Emil Ivov
- Re: [MMUSIC] Comment on SIP Trickle ICE based on … Christer Holmberg
- Re: [MMUSIC] Comment on SIP Trickle ICE based on … Parthasarathi R
- Re: [MMUSIC] Comment on SIP Trickle ICE based on … Parthasarathi R